What You Will Do

  • Development Programming: Develops and implements leadership & management development, solutions, in service of the organizations talent pipeline goals and bench strength issues. Design, develop, coordinate, implement, deliver, and evaluate training programs that support the organizations objectives and are aligned with the business plan. Trains trainers and ensures instructional quality.

  • Consulting: Serves as a consultant to leadership for assigned client groups: discusses and identifies training and development needs, and participates in the evaluation and monitoring of training programs by following up with training participants and managers to ensure training objectives are met and applied.

  • Talent Development: Partners with leadership on talent review, succession planning, and talent development processes. Develops and recommends specific action steps to help leader address identified issues.

  • Change Management: Facilitates organizational development and change management programs for leaders and employees, and specific teams and work groups. Provides coaching, facilitation, and whole systems analysis in consultation with leaders to implement improvement initiatives and ensure alignment with strategic plans.

  • Stakeholder Partnership & Communication: Regularly communicate with client group to determine needs, outcomes, and satisfaction. Identifies issues and trouble shoots them as appropriate. Works collaboratively with key partners including entity human resources officer, HR generalist, system education leaders, and other leadership to ensure effective deployment of content.
